CLOCK HOURSFor each 60 minutes of approved in-service education including reasonable time for breaks and passing time, one continuing education credit hour shall be granted.  Clock hours are provided by the Office of the Superintendent of Public Instruction (OSPI) and are applicable towards ESA Certification AND nursing certification renewal through ANCC. Follow these steps to find your Gen Ed transition What-If report: Login to Banner Click Student Services tab Click Student Records Click CAPP Report Select Fall Semester 2023 Click View Previous Reports (see the bottom of the screen) Click GenEd Transition Review report Click Submit.
